क्या हम पायथन कोड को एन्क्रिप्ट कर सकते हैं?
क्या हम पायथन कोड को एन्क्रिप्ट कर सकते हैं?

वीडियो: क्या हम पायथन कोड को एन्क्रिप्ट कर सकते हैं?

वीडियो: क्या हम पायथन कोड को एन्क्रिप्ट कर सकते हैं?
वीडियो: Encryption Using Python | Python Beginner to Advance in Hindi #21 2024, नवंबर
Anonim

पायथन को एन्क्रिप्ट करना स्रोत कोड की एक विधि है अजगर obfuscation,”जिसका उद्देश्य मूल स्रोत को संग्रहीत करना है कोड एक ऐसे रूप में जो मनुष्यों के लिए अपठनीय है। वास्तव में रिवर्स इंजीनियर या सी ++ को अनकंपाइल करने के लिए प्रोग्राम उपलब्ध हैं कोड मानव पठनीय रूप में वापस।

यह भी जानना है कि क्या पायथन कोड को एन्क्रिप्ट किया जा सकता है?

इसका एक उदाहरण पैरामिको एसएसएच मॉड्यूल है अजगर , जो एक निर्भरता के रूप में PyCrypto का उपयोग करता है एन्क्रिप्ट जानकारी। PyCrypto बहुत ही सरल है, फिर भी अत्यंत शक्तिशाली और उपयोगी है कूटलेखन के अंदर अजगर प्रोग्रामिंग भाषा। की मूल बातें का ज्ञान कूटलेखन होना भी एक बहुत ही उपयोगी कौशल है।

इसी तरह, PyInstaller कैसे काम करता है? पाय इंस्टालर आपके द्वारा लिखित एक पायथन लिपि पढ़ता है। यह हर दूसरे मॉड्यूल को खोजने के लिए आपके कोड का विश्लेषण करता है और आपकी स्क्रिप्ट को निष्पादित करने के लिए लाइब्रेरी की आवश्यकता होती है। फिर यह उन सभी फाइलों की प्रतियां एकत्र करता है - जिसमें सक्रिय पायथन दुभाषिया भी शामिल है! वे करना पायथन या किसी मॉड्यूल के किसी विशेष संस्करण को स्थापित करने की आवश्यकता नहीं है।

यह भी पूछा गया, क्या हम पायथन कोड संकलित कर सकते हैं?

अजगर , एक गतिशील भाषा के रूप में, "नहीं हो सकती" संकलित "मशीन में" कोड स्थिर रूप से, जैसे C या COBOL कर सकते हैं . आप निष्पादित करने के लिए हमेशा एक दुभाषिया की आवश्यकता होगी कोड , जो, भाषा में परिभाषा के अनुसार, एक गतिशील ऑपरेशन है।

पायथन कैसे सोर्स कोड को कंपाइल और रन करता है?

अजगर प्रथम संकलित आपका सोर्स कोड (. py फ़ाइल) बाइट के रूप में जाने जाने वाले प्रारूप में कोड . संकलन केवल एक अनुवाद चरण है, और बाइट कोड एक निम्न-स्तरीय, और प्लेटफ़ॉर्म-स्वतंत्र, आपका प्रतिनिधित्व करता है सोर्स कोड . संकलित कोड में आमतौर पर संग्रहित किया जाता है।

सिफारिश की: